Dhaka, 28 July 2026: Professor Dr. Selim Raihan, Professor in the Department of Economics at the University of Dhaka and Executive Director of the South Asian Network on Economic Modeling (SANEM), has joined the Board of Trustees of Transparency International Bangladesh (TIB) as a new member. He attended the 128th meeting of the TIB Board of Trustees held on 28 July 2026. Dr. Raihan will serve as a member of the Board for a three-year term.
Professor Raihan obtained his postgraduate degree from the University of Dhaka and his PhD from the University of Manchester, UK. He serves as a member of the Board of Directors of the Global Development Network (GDN). He is also an Honorary Senior Research Fellow at the University of Manchester and an alumnus of Harvard University’s programme on “Cutting Edge of Development Thinking”.
The Board of Trustees is the highest policy-making body of TIB. The other members of the Board are noted human rights activist and founder of the floating hospital “Jibon Tari”, Monsur Ahmed Choudhuri, Chairperson; and The Daily Star Publisher and Editor Mahfuz Anam, Treasurer. Other members are Advocate Susmita Chakma, Philip Gain, Banasree Paul, Faruque Ahmed, Tahera Yasmin, and Barrister Manzoor Hasan.
